A safe, compassionate approach makes this difficult subject accessible: attendees value knowledgeable, empathetic trainers who create space for honest discussion without pressure. They describe clear, well-paced sessions combining practical frameworks, language, scenarios, role play, videos and breakout activities, supported by useful workbooks and signposting resources. The course helps them recognise warning signs, ask direct questions and feel more confident supporting people in crisis at work and beyond.
